

.daohang{width:1000px; margin:0 auto;}
.main{ position:relative;}

.iwbp{ background:url(../bg/ibg2.gif) top no-repeat; overflow:hidden; top:-46px; padding-top:46px; margin-bottom:-46px;}

.mtb{ background:url(../bg/mtb.png) no-repeat; height:71px; position:relative; top:-25px; margin-bottom:-25px; z-index:9;}

.mtb h2.isc{ background:url(../bg/i_sc.gif) 16px 32px no-repeat; height:32px; padding:32px 0 0 16px;}

.mtb ul.qq{ position:absolute; top:11px; left:617px;}

ul.qq{}

ul.qq li{ float:left; padding-right:6px;}

ul.qq li a{ width:39px; height:38px; display:block;}

.lb,.rb{ float:left; display:inline;}

.scrb{ position:relative; overflow:hidden;}

.scrb ul{ position:absolute; width:20000em;}

.scrb ul li{ float:left;}

.i_p1{ height:343px; overflow:hidden; padding-top:15px;}

.i_p1 .lb{ width:288px; float:left; margin:0 2px 0 8px;}

.i_p1 .lb a{ width:288px; height:306px; display:block; text-align:center; position:relative; padding-top:5px;}

.i_p1 .lb a ins{ width:288px; height:311px; position:absolute; top:0; left:0; background:url(../bg/cov1.png) no-repeat; cursor:pointer;}

.i_p1 .rb{ height:325px; padding-top:2px; position:relative; width:691px; background:url(../bg/iscr.jpg) center bottom no-repeat;}

.i_p1 .rb a.more{ width:59px; height:14px; position:absolute; top:294px; right:8px;}

.b1{ width:691px; height:252px;}

ul.sc{}

ul.sc li,ul.sc2 li{ float:left; padding-right:5px;}

ul.sc li a,ul.sc2 li a{ width:218px; height:243px; display:block; background:url(../bg/sc.gif) no-repeat; padding:9px 0 0 9px;}

ul.sc li a span,ul.sc2 li a span{ display:block; font-family:Verdana, Geneva, sans-serif; font-size:10px; color:#848484; text-align:right; padding-right:9px; padding-top:10px; margin-bottom:5px;}

ul.sc li a h3,ul.sc2 li a h3{ color:#fff; line-height:14px; padding-top:10px;}
h3{ margin:0; padding:0;}
ul.sc li a h3 i,ul.sc2 li a h3 i{ display:block; font-size:10px; color:#ffba00; text-transform:uppercase;}

ul.sc li a:hover,ul.sc2 li a:hover{ background-position:right top;}

dl.tab01{ position:absolute; top:266px; left:570px;}

dl.tab01 dd{ background:url(../bg/ball.gif) no-repeat; width:17px; height:18px; float:left; cursor:pointer; margin-right:3px;}

dl.tab01 dd.active{ background-position:right top;}

.i_p2{ height:345px; overflow:hidden;}

.i_p2 .lb{ width:471px;}

.i_p2 .rb{ width:529px; background:url(../bg/ico_2.gif)  no-repeat;}

.i_p2 h2{ height:45px;}

.i_p2 h2 a{ width:76px; float:right; height:45px;}

ul.ihs{ padding:16px 0 0 14px;}

ul.ihs li{ float:left; padding-right:10px;}

ul.ihs li a{ width:142px; height:270px; position:relative; display:block; text-align:center; padding-top:3px;}

ul.ihs li a ins{ background:url(../bg/ihs.png) no-repeat; width:142px; height:158px; position:absolute; top:0; left:0; cursor:pointer;}

ul.ihs li a ins.p{ top:63px;}

ul.ihs li a img{ margin-bottom:25px;}

* html ul.ihs li a ins{ background:url(../bg/ihs.png) no-repeat;}

ul.ihs li a:hover ins{ background-position:right top;}


* html ul.ihs li a:hover ins{ background:url(../bg/ihs.png) right top no-repeat;}


ul.ihs li a i,.b2 a i{ display:block; font-family:Georgia, "Times New Roman", Times, serif; font-size:14px; font-style:italic; color:#2e2e2e; line-height:30px;}

ul.ihs li a i big,.b2 a i big{ font-size:24px; padding-left:4px;}

ul.ihs li a h3{font-size:10px; color:#5d5e5d; text-transform:uppercase; padding:10px 0 20px;}

ul.ihs li a h3 b{ display:block; font-size:14px; color:#ffba00; font-family:"微软雅黑"; font-weight:normal;}

ul.ihs li a em,.b2 a em{ width:46px; height:46px; position:absolute; top:114px; left:0; z-index:9;}

ul.ihs li a em.a{ background:url(../bg/a.png) no-repeat;}

ul.ihs li a em.b{ background:url(../bg/b.png) no-repeat; top:176px;}

ul.ihs li a em.c{ background:url(../bg/c.png) no-repeat;}

.b2 a em.a{ background:url(../bg/a1.png) no-repeat;}

.b2 a em.b{ background:url(../bg/b1.png) no-repeat;}

.b2 a em.c{ background:url(../bg/c1.png) no-repeat;}

.b2 a em.d{ background:url(../bg/d.png) no-repeat;}

.b2 a em.e{ background:url(../bg/e.png) no-repeat;}

.b2 a em.f{ background:url(../bg/f.png) no-repeat;}

.b2 a em.g{ background:url(../bg/g.png) no-repeat;}

.b2 a em.h{ background:url(../bg/h.png) no-repeat;}

.b2 a em.i{ background:url(../bg/i.png) no-repeat;}

.b2 a em.j{ background:url(../bg/j.png) no-repeat;}

.b2 a em.k{ background:url(../bg/k.png) no-repeat;}

.b2 a em.l{ background:url(../bg/l.png) no-repeat;}

.b2 a em.m{ background:url(../bg/m.png) no-repeat;}

.b2 a em.n{ background:url(../bg/n.png) no-repeat;}

.b2 a em.o{ background:url(../bg/o.png) no-repeat;}

.b2 a em.p{ background:url(../bg/p.png) no-repeat;}

ul.ihs li a:hover em,.b2 a:hover em{ background-position:0 bottom;}

dl.ihn{ padding:14px 0 0 10px;}


dl.ihn dt{ float:left; margin-right:10px; display:inline; width:220px; height:260px; border:#ffb901 solid 1px; padding:3px;  }



dl.ihn dt a h3{ font-size:10px; text-transform:uppercase; color:#999; padding-top:12px; line-height:18px;}

dl.ihn dt a h3 span{ display:block; font-family:"微软雅黑"; color:#b31010; font-size:12px; background:url(../bg/ico_4.gif) 0 8px no-repeat; padding-left:9px;}

dl.ihn dd{ border-bottom:1px dashed #e6e6e6; margin-bottom:4px; float:left; width:261px; padding:0 3px 4px;}

dl.ihn dd a{ height:36px; display:block; overflow:hidden;}

dl.ihn dd a h4{ color:#333; font-family:"微软雅黑"; font-size:14px;}

dl.ihn dd a b{ display:block; font-size:10px; color:#999; height:20px; font-weight:normal;}

dl.ihn dd a b i{ float:left;}

dl.ihn dd a b span{ float:right;}

dl.ihn dd a:hover h4{ color:#f1ae00;}

.i_p3{ height:350px; background:url(../bg/ico_5.gif) 355px 272px no-repeat; position:relative;}

.i_p3 h2{ height:45px; margin-bottom:16px;}

dl.ill{ width:1020px; position:absolute; top:61px; left:3px;}

dl.ill dt{ float:left; padding-right:8px;}

dl.ill dt a{ background:url(../bg/ico_6.gif) no-repeat; width:336px; height:253px; display:block; padding:9px 0 0 9px; position:relative;}

dl.ill a h3,.llb a h3{ font-family:"微软雅黑"; color:#fff; padding-left:10px; font-size:14px;}

dl.ill dt a h3,dl.ill dt a h3 i,.llb a h3,.llb a h3 i{ height:37px; width:317px; position:absolute; top:169px; left:9px; line-height:37px; padding-left:10px;}

dl.ill dt a h3 i,.llb a h3 i,.llb a:hover p i{ background-color:#000; filter:alpha(opacity=70); opacity:0.7; top:0; left:0;}

dl.ill dt a h3 span,.llb a h3 span{ position:relative; z-index:9;}

dl.ill a p{ line-height:21px; color:#827f7f; padding:14px 10px 0; cursor:pointer;}

dl.ill a p b{ color:#2d2d2d;}

dl.ill dd{ float:left;}

dl.ill dd a{ width:211px; height:203px; display:block; background:url(../bg/ico_7.gif) no-repeat; padding:8px 0 0 8px; position:relative;}

dl.ill dd a h3{ background:url(../bg/ico_8.jpg) no-repeat; width:182px; height:29px; line-height:26px; position:absolute; top:102px; left:3px;}

dl.ill dd p{ padding:18px 32px 0 6px;}

dl.ill dd a:hover h3{ background-position:right top;}

.i_p2 h3 b.green{ color:#49b500; font-weight:bold;}

.i_p2 h3 b.blue{ color:#2ab8c4; font-weight:bold;}

.i_p2 h3 b.orange{color:#df7505; font-weight:bold;}

#root{ width:270px; float:left;}
#root2 a,#root13 a{  margin-bottom:2px; padding-bottom:2px; color:#b21010; font-size:14px;}
#root11 { border-bottom:#999 dotted 1px; margin-bottom:2px; padding-bottom:2px; color:#7f7f7f; text-indent:2em; }

#root2 a:hover,#root13 a:hover{  margin-bottom:2px; padding-bottom:2px; color:#ffba00; font-size:14px;}

